Newton

Newton is Greater Boston's benchmark family suburb, a city of around 88,000 people about 7 miles west of downtown, organized into 13 distinct villages each with its own commercial center, character, and price point. The median sale price runs between $1.5 and $1.85 million depending on the village, with single family homes averaging close to $1.9 million and condos around $685,000. Newton Public Schools rank among the top 10 districts in Massachusetts, and the city has the best transit profile in the corridor, with the Green Line D branch, three Framingham/Worcester commuter rail stations, and direct Mass Pike access. Newton was the first city in Greater Boston to adopt MBTA 3A zoning, with the Village Center Overlay District passed in December 2023 and full state compliance reached in 2025, which has materially changed development potential in the village centers.
